Everyday Usage of Beige Long Sleeve Dresses

Beige long sleeve dresses merge timeless style with practicality. In everyday life, you can rely on these versatile pieces for a range of occasions, such as:

  • Office Wear: A tailored or shift dress in beige offers a polished, professional look. Pair with pumps or ankle boots and subtle jewelry.
  • Casual Outings: Opt for a knitted or shirt dress. These are comfortable yet stylish, ideal for running errands, coffee dates, or a relaxed brunch.
  • Transitional Weather: Long sleeves provide added warmth, making these dresses perfect for spring and fall.
  • Layering Made Easy: Wear with a trench coat in cooler months, or add a belt and sandals for warmer days. Beige acts as a neutral base for accessories and layering pieces.

Fashion tip: Beige long sleeve dresses effortlessly transition from day to night. Add statement earrings or swap sneakers for heels to instantly elevate your look.

How to Choose the Right Beige Long Sleeve Dress

Selecting your perfect beige long sleeve dress involves thoughtful consideration of personal style, purpose, and fit. Follow these guidelines to find your match:

1. Decide the Occasion

  • Work or Formal: Tailored, shift, or shirt dresses in structured materials like cotton blends, wool, or woven fabrics.
  • Casual Daywear: Knitted, jersey, or shirt dresses—look for relaxed fits and soft textures.
  • Special Events: Satin, lace, or open-back dresses for an elevated vibe.

2. Pick the Length for Comfort & Style

  • Mini: Playful, best for informal events or parties.
  • Midi: Most versatile, can be dressed up or down.
  • Maxi: Elegant, suited for formal affairs or when seeking more coverage.

3. Fabric Matters

  • Cotton & Linen: Lightweight, breathable, best for everyday and warm weather.
  • Knits: Offer stretch and comfort—great for chillier seasons.
  • Woven & Tailored: Provide structure, ideal for formalities.
  • Satin & Lace: High glamour for evenings and parties.

4. Focus on Fit

  • Bodycon: Accentuates curves.
  • Wrap: Universally flattering and adjustable.
  • Shift/Kaftan: Loose and relaxed.
  • Tailored/Fitted: Sharp, professional impact.

5. Explore Details

  • Puff or Statement Sleeves: Add drama and current style appeal.
  • Buttons, Ties, or Belts: Offer definition and allow customization.
  • Open Back, Frills, or Lace Insets: For statement-making style.

6. Consider Color Undertones

  • Beige comes in warm (sand, camel), neutral, or cool (taupe, stone) variations. Try on a few to find what complements your complexion.

User Tips for Styling & Care

To maximize the wear and enjoyment of your beige long sleeve dress:

  • Layer with Purpose: Add blazers, long coats, or scarves in fall/winter. Try a denim jacket or lightweight cardigan in spring.
  • Accessorize Creatively: Use bold shoes, belts, and jewelry to inject personality. Animal print, gold, and black accessories are particularly chic with beige.
  • Switch Up Footwear: Sneakers for day, boots for chillier weather, or strappy sandals for an evening out.
  • Take Care of the Fabric: Always check care labels. Many knits and delicate blends benefit from hand-washing or low heat laundry. For linen and cotton, steam or iron lightly to avoid wrinkles.
  • Stain Management: Carry a stain remover pen. Beige is light, so prompt action on spills helps maintain its fresh look.
  • Storage: Hang structured dresses, fold knits to retain shape, and use padded hangers for delicate materials to prevent stretching.

FAQ

  1. What shoes go best with a beige long sleeve dress?
    Neutral shades like nude, tan, black, or white are the safest bets. For bolder styling, opt for metallics, animal print, or even bright accent shoes like red or emerald. Boots, sneakers, or sandals can all work depending on the occasion and dress length.

  2. How do I prevent my beige dress from becoming see-through?
    Opt for styles with a lining, especially in lighter or fitted materials. Wear nude or beige seamless undergarments for a discreet finish. If you’re still concerned, a slip dress underneath offers extra coverage.

  3. Can I wear a beige long sleeve dress to a formal event?
    Absolutely. Choose a maxi or midi made from satin, lace, or another elegant fabric. Pair it with heels, statement jewelry, and a clutch for a sophisticated evening look.

  4. Is beige suitable for all skin tones?
    Yes, but experiment with different undertones—cool, warm, or neutral—to see which flatters you most. Lighter, sand-toned beiges tend to suit a wider range of complexions.

  5. How do I accessorize a beige dress for a wedding?
    Go for metallic accessories (gold or silver), statement earrings, and a colorful or embellished clutch. Add elegant heels or sandals. Avoid white accessories to keep the look wedding-appropriate.

  6. What’s the difference between a shift and a shirt dress?
    A shift dress is simple and loose, typically with no waist definition or embellishments. A shirt dress mimics a button-up shirt—often collared, with buttons and sometimes a waist tie—offering a more structured look.

  7. Can I wear a beige long sleeve dress in both summer and winter?
    Yes. In summer, opt for breathable fabrics like cotton or linen and lighter styles. In winter, look for knits or wool blends and style the dress with tights, boots, and cozy layers.

  8. How do I prevent stains on a beige dress?
    Try to avoid high-risk food and drinks, and treat stains quickly with a stain remover. Always follow care instructions—washing or spot-cleaning as recommended—to maintain color and fabric integrity.

  9. Are there plus-size options for beige long sleeve dresses?
    Yes, many brands offer inclusive sizing, from mini to maxi lengths and relaxed to tailored fits. Check the size guide and look for reviews to ensure a comfortable, flattering fit.

  10. What outerwear works best with a beige long sleeve dress?
    Trench coats, tailored blazers, denim jackets, leather moto jackets, and long cardigans all pair beautifully. Choose color contrasts (like black, navy, or camel) for a polished finish, or tonal layers for a chic, minimalist look.
